APM Project Management Qualification (PMQ)

The APM Project Management Qualification (PMQ) is an internationally recognised benchmark for project management training. Accredited by the Association for Project Management (the chartered body for the project profession), the PMQ is a knowledge-based qualification that enables you to understand the breadth of skills required to manage a project successfully.

Why choose the APM Project Management Qualification (PMQ)?

If you are looking to prove your skills as a professional project manager, the PMQ validates project management knowledge for individual assignments up to large capital projects.  The PMQ covers knowledge areas from the APM Body of Knowledge, including budgeting and cost management, conflict management, communication, earned value management, leadership, negotiation, procurement, sponsorship, and teamwork.

The key facts about your online training

Certification: APM Project Management Qualification (PMQ)

Study time: 70 – 80 hours (including self-study)

Vendor: APM

Provider: ILX

Student support: StudentCare™, Career Services and expert mentoring

Prerequisites: Candidates attending the professional programme would benefit from having a minimum of two years of relevant practical experience in project management

Assessment: 1 x 180-minute exam (answering 10 from 16 questions) or, 1 x 120-minute exam for PRINCE2® Registered Practitioners (answering six from 10 questions)

Resources: Internet access and email

Ideal for: Applicants typically have some pre-existing project management knowledge or those progressing to the next step from the APM Project Fundamentals (PFQ) qualification

Included in your modules

Essential skills for your career

Understand how organisations and projects are structured
Understand project life cycles
Understand the situational context of projects
Understand communication within project management
Understand the principles of leadership and teamwork
Understand planning for success
Understand project scope management
Understand schedule and resource optimisation
Understand project procurement
Understand risk and issue management in the context of project management
Understand quality in the context of a project
